An old aluminum wash tub or pale can be spray painted black or left it's natural color. If you have an old washtub or find one at a second-hand thrift store, it can be turned on it's side and bury about 1/3 of it. Buy a hanging plant such as petunias that bloom profusely. Build the soil up (add conditioned soil) into a slight mound. Bury the plant half way into the tub and it will look like the flowers are spilling out of it.

You could use old sturdy wooden boxes. Some metal pails would also work. Just be sure that whatever you use will need to have some holes for proper drainage.
